Karlshamn Port is a major seaport located in southern Sweden on the Baltic Sea coast. It serves as an important hub for both cargo and passenger traffic. The port is well-connected to domestic and international shipping routes, facilitating the transport of goods such as paper, timber, and chemicals. It also features modern infrastructure, including terminals for container, bulk, and Ro-Ro (roll-on/roll-off) shipping. With its strategic location, Karlshamn Port plays a vital role in the regional economy, supporting trade and industry in Sweden and beyond.
Klaipeda Port is the largest and busiest seaport in Lithuania, located on the Baltic Sea. It serves as a key gateway for trade, passenger services and logistics in the region, handling a wide range of cargo, including containers, bulk, and general cargo. The port is strategically positioned at the crossroads of major European trade routes, offering excellent connectivity to international markets. Klaipeda Port features modern infrastructure, including specialised terminals, and plays a crucial role in supporting Lithuania's economy and regional trade. It is also an important hub for passenger ferry services.
